    Why is it that it's OK for guys to have nice bikes - but not us girls

    Well it's not an argument starter (hopefully). I just want to know why is it that some guys just can't get it in their thick skulls that girls/women like to have nice things also.
    I have a 1994 Kawasaki ZX9R and I'm proud of that. I get comments like "Oh aren't you spoilt having your mum & dad buy that for you" and "whats a good looking girl like you doing with a big bike like that!". It's so stupid. I must admit that in the last few months it has got better or maybe I'm just ignoring them more.

    Is it just that some guys feel inferior to women on bikes?
    Is it that they feel they can't compete?
    Or maybe it's just the fact that they don't know how to act around us!!.

    My best friend (also my passenger on my race sidecar) is a guy who doesn't have a problem and its so nice to actually hear compliments about my bike for once.

    I ride with an all girl group called Babes On Bikes - we don't have rules or anything like that - its a group of women riders that get together and have a great time on our bikes. I hear of guys saying "oh I wouldn't ride with a women - they ride too slow" but hey that's crap - half the time when us girls ride together we leave the boys behind.

    I think it's time NZ really woke up to the idea that women are on the agenda for having just as nice things as the men. What do you think?? Do you agree? How can attitudes be changed? Every thought welcome - politeness is promised in replies.
